Inaccurate readings

Very inaccurate, not recommended. This was used to test a 2013 Subaru Legacy with an engine under 60k and no known engine issues. No burning or oil leakage, no power issues, dealer tested. Tests showed more than 40 psi below expected levels. In the 135-140psi range when the spec is 185+, tested multiple times on multiple cylinders. Rented a cheap pressure gauge from O'Reilly and the numbers were much closer, 165-170psi. The unit also had small nicks and nicks all over it that looked either used or mishandled when assembled. The device's design made it relatively easy to connect the cylinders, but there's not much point in a sensor giving you the wrong numbers. I guess I'm saving up for a better one.
